Common symptoms and what they can mean
Burner will not ignite
On gas models, a burner that does not light may be dealing with an ignition problem, burner cap misalignment, blocked burner ports, moisture around the igniter, a failed switch, or a spark module issue. If the clicking is present but ignition is delayed, the problem may be different from a burner that produces no clicking at all.
If ignition trouble follows a spill or recent cleaning, residue or moisture may be part of the issue. If the problem has been getting progressively worse over time, worn ignition components become more likely.
Clicking that continues after the burner lights
Constant clicking can be caused by moisture, contamination around the burner head, a mispositioned cap, or a failing ignition switch. When the clicking does not stop after flame appears, the range may still be usable in a limited sense, but continued use is not ideal if the symptom keeps returning. Repeated spark activity can point to an electrical issue that should be checked before it leads to additional component wear.
Oven not heating or taking too long to preheat
If the oven stays cold, preheats very slowly, or never gets close to the selected temperature, the cause may involve the bake system, igniter, heating element, sensor, control board, relay, or incoming power depending on the model configuration. A range that appears to start normally but does not build heat often needs testing beyond a visual inspection.
When the problem affects bake but broil still works, that difference is useful. When both bake and broil struggle, the repair path may shift toward control or power-related causes.
Uneven cooking or temperature drift
Inconsistent baking results often develop gradually. Cookies brown unevenly, casseroles take longer in the center, or recipes that used to be predictable now finish early or late. These symptoms can point to a drifting temperature sensor, weak heating performance, airflow issues, calibration problems, or a control fault that is not cycling heat correctly.
Because the oven may still feel warm and appear to be operating, temperature drift is easy to ignore at first. In practice, it is one of the most common reasons owners begin looking into repair.
Display or touch control problems
A blank display, nonresponsive controls, random beeping, error behavior, or functions that will not start can indicate a user interface problem, control board failure, wiring issue, or electrical supply problem. In some cases, what looks like an oven heating failure is actually the result of the range not sending the proper command to the heating system.
Convection or broil functions not working correctly
If convection no longer improves cooking results, the fan is unusually loud, or the broil function is weak or inoperative, the issue may be limited to a specific circuit or component rather than the entire appliance. That distinction matters because targeted repairs are often more reasonable than assuming the whole range has reached the end of its service life.
Useful observations before service
Before a repair visit, it helps to note a few simple details:
- Which burner or oven function is affected
- Whether the problem is constant or intermittent
- Any recent spillovers, deep cleaning, or power interruptions
- Whether error messages appear
- If the issue happens more often after preheating or extended cooking
These observations do not replace testing, but they can make diagnosis more efficient and reduce guesswork.
When to stop using the range
Some symptoms are more than an inconvenience. Stop normal use and have the appliance assessed if you notice any of the following:
- A strong or persistent gas smell
- Sparking that seems abnormal or continues unexpectedly
- Burners that fail repeatedly after proper positioning and cleaning
- The oven overheating or failing to regulate temperature
- Shutoffs, tripped breakers, burning odors, or signs of electrical stress
These situations can move beyond routine performance issues and should not be dismissed as minor quirks.

Repair or replacement: what usually makes sense
Repair is often worthwhile when the problem is isolated, the range is otherwise performing well, and the overall condition of the appliance remains solid. Replacement becomes more likely when there are multiple major failures, extensive electronic damage, repeated expensive repairs, or clear signs that reliability has been declining across several systems.
The best decision usually depends on the appliance’s age, the failed components involved, parts availability, and how the range has been performing before the current issue started. A symptom-based inspection is the most reliable way to judge whether repair is still the sensible option.
